Overview

If you’ve ever been in a romantic relationship, you might be able to relate to “Defending the Caveman.” This one-man performance details the ins and outs of how couple communicate. Or, rather, how they don’t communicate. Filled with laughter, this show is a riot from start to finish.

Description

from Defending the Caveman
Defending the Caveman speaks to anyone who has ever been in a relationship.

The one-man performance carries on like a conversation and dives into the differences couples may face through witty banter and insightful observations that teach the audience they’re not alone in navigating relationships – the ways one fights, laughs and loves.
